Jewels Forreal springs 8-1 upset in Meadows distaff
November 13, 2018,Washington, PA — Jewels Forreal stalked her stablemate McDazzle from the pocket, then roared past in the Lightning Lane to spring an 8-1 upset in Tuesday’s (Nov. 13) $18,000 Fillies and Mares Preferred Handicap Pace at The Meadows.
McDazzle, who was bidding to extend her winning streak to four, turned back a stern third-quarter challenge from Easy Three. But that effort may have weakened her, as the 3-year-old Jewels Forreal had little trouble downing her 4-year-old stablemate by half a length for Mike Wilder in 1:54.2 over a surface rated good. Keystone Riptide completed the ticket.
Ron Burke trains Jewels Forreal, a daughter of So Surreal and Dandy’s Jewel who lifted her lifetime bankroll to $169,313, for Burke Racing Stable and Weaver Bruscemi LLC.
